Spaghetti with balls in tomato-cinnamon sauce
A tasty Italian recipe. The main course contains the following ingredients: meat, multigrain spaghetti (pack 500 g), olive oil, Dutch beef meatballs (about 360 g), onion (chopped), winter carrot ((bag 1 kilo), diced), ground cinnamon (jar 37 g), sifted tomatoes (passata di pomodoro, 500 g), mint ((container 15 g) and in strips).

Cook the spaghetti al dente according to the instructions on the package. Heat the oil in a frying pan and fry the meatballs around brown in 3-4 min. Place them on a plate with a slotted spoon.
-
Fry the onion 1 min. In the shortening of the meatballs. Add the carrot and cook for 4 minutes. Scoop the cinnamon and put the meatballs back in the pan. Pour the passata into the pan and heat for another 5 minutes. Add the fresh mint and pepper and salt to taste.
-
Drain the spaghetti and add to the balls in tomato cinnamon sauce. Divide the spaghetti over 4 deep plates and serve.
